Casey Beelen is a 2022 RHP/OF with a 5-11 185 lb. frame from Lawrenceville, GA who attends Peachtree Ridge. Recorded a 7.25 second sixty-yard dash time. Primary Right-Handed pitcher with a medium, athletic build physically. Uses a side-rocker step into a high leg lift and remains online during his delivery. Coming from a high, over-the-top arm slot with shorter arm action, getting natural cut on his fastball. Filled up the strike zone in gameplay with command of both sides of the plate. Fastball ranged from 74-76 miles per hour while also showing feel for a change-up in the low-70s. Secondary outfielder, approaches aggressively but under control, and plays through the ball well with good footwork that can be choppy at times. Right-handed hitter with a balanced swing that remains on one linear plane, some power to pull side. Quiet lower half that could be used more in his swing. Projects more on the mound could see velocity tick with more incorporation of lower half. Excellent student.

Swing Efficiency™
Swing Efficiency™ is a score from 0-100 based on how fast you move your body compared to other players of a similar height and weight. Our library of over 10,000 hitters shows that for a given body type, higher swing efficiencies generate higher exit velos. PG All-American Arjun Nimmala may only weigh 170 lbs, but he can still hit 103MPH off a tee thanks to his elite Swing Efficiency™.
